Today, Gray Television operates 113 television markets, reaching approximately 36% of U.S. television households, making it the nation's largest owner of top-rated local television stations and digital assets.
Competitive Advantage
Gray Television's success can be attributed to its unwavering commitment to delivering exceptional local content and leveraging the power of its diverse portfolio of stations. The company's stations are recognized for their strong market positions, with 77 markets hosting the top-rated television station and 100 markets featuring the first or second-highest-rated television station. Additionally, Gray Television boasts the largest Telemundo Affiliate group, with 43 markets totaling nearly 1.5 million Hispanic TV Households.
Financials
In terms of financial performance, Gray Television has demonstrated resilience and growth. As of the most recent 10-Q filing in 2024, the company reported quarterly revenue of $950 million, an 18% increase from the same period in the previous year. While the company's net income attributable to common shareholders for the quarter was $83 million, a significant improvement from the $53 million net loss in the same quarter of 2023, the company's full-year 2024 core advertising revenue is expected to be slightly down, which is not unusual in a political year.
The company's operating cash flow (OCF) for the most recent quarter stood at $297 million, while free cash flow (FCF) was $257 million. These figures demonstrate Gray Television's ability to generate substantial cash from its operations, providing financial flexibility for future investments and debt reduction.
Liquidity
Gray Television's financial strength is further highlighted by its strong balance sheet and liquidity position. As of September 30, 2024, the company's leverage ratio, calculated in accordance with its senior credit agreement and net of all cash, stood at 5.67 to 1.00, a testament to its commitment to reducing debt. In fact, the company expects to reduce its total net debt outstanding by approximately $500 million by the end of 2024.
The company's debt-to-equity ratio as of the most recent quarter was 2.80, indicating a relatively high level of debt financing. However, Gray Television maintains a solid liquidity position with $69 million in cash and a $680 million revolving credit facility, of which $674 million was available as of September 30, 2024. The company's current ratio and quick ratio both stand at 1.13, suggesting a healthy ability to meet short-term obligations.
Cost Containment and Efficiency
The company's strategic focus on cost containment has also been a key driver of its financial performance. In August 2024, Gray Television launched a significant cost-cutting initiative, identifying and implementing various measures that are expected to reduce the company's operating expense run rate by approximately $60 million on an annualized basis. These initiatives, which primarily involve non-personnel expense categories, are designed to enhance the company's profitability and efficiency without compromising its commitment to serving local communities.
Digital Growth
Gray Television's digital presence has also been a area of focus, with the company's digital advertising sales continuing to experience double-digit growth rates and new records for digital ad revenue. In the third quarter of 2024, the company had 22 markets that generated more than $1 million in digital ad sales, a new record for the company.

For the fourth quarter of 2024, Gray Television anticipates core advertising revenues to be down compared to Q4 2023, citing factors such as political displacement and the move of Southeastern Conference Football from CBS to ABC. However, the company expects to generate approximately $500 million in political revenue for the full year 2024, making it the largest recipient of political ad dollars in the television broadcasting business on both a gross and per TV household basis.
Business Segments
Gray Television operates through two main business segments: broadcasting and production companies.
Broadcasting Segment
The broadcasting segment is the company's primary revenue driver, operating television stations in local markets across the United States. This segment generates revenue through advertising (including core and political advertising), retransmission consent fees, and other sources such as production of television and event programming, television commercials, tower rentals, and management fees.
For the nine months ended September 30, 2024, the broadcasting segment generated $2.53 billion in revenue less agency commissions and reported an operating income of $611 million. The primary operating expenses for this segment include employee compensation, related benefits, and programming costs, as well as overhead expenses such as maintenance, supplies, insurance, rent, and utilities.
Production Companies Segment
The production companies segment includes the production of television content and Gray's production facilities, primarily Assembly Atlanta. Key operations in this segment include Raycom Sports, Tupelo Media Group, PowerNation Studios, and Assembly Atlanta. Revenue for this segment is primarily generated through direct sales of production services.
While smaller in scale compared to the broadcasting segment, the production companies segment contributed $68 million in revenue less agency commissions for the nine months ended September 30, 2024, with an operating income of $3 million.
